Overview of Dental Labs in Vietnam
Over the years, the landscape of dental laboratories in Vietnam has transformed dramatically. Initially, these facilities were limited in scope and capabilities. However, with advancements in dental technology—such as CAD/CAM systems, 3D printing, and improved materials—dental labs have significantly increased their service offerings. They now provide a range of sophisticated services, including digital smile design, custom implant abutments, and complex orthodontic appliances. This evolution has not only improved the quality of dental products but also reduced turnaround times, making dental processes more efficient for both professionals and patients.
Materials used in dental labs often include metals, ceramics, and composites that are essential for creating durable and visually appealing restorations. Commonly utilized materials include zirconia, porcelain, and resin, each selected for its specific properties tailored to meet the aesthetic and functional needs of dental solutions. Generally, a dental lab operates with various specialized departments—such as model work, casting, finishing, and quality control—to streamline processes and enhance the final product’s quality. Technological Advancements and Innovations
The dental laboratory sector in Vietnam has undergone a significant transformation, driven by a rapid integration of technological advancements. One of the most important innovations is the introduction of Computer-Aided Design and Computer-Aided Manufacturing (CAD/CAM) systems. These systems enable dental technicians to create precise dental restorations and prosthetics with enhanced efficiency. Utilizing CAD/CAM technology, dental labs can produce crowns, bridges, Vietnam dental lab and other dental appliances with remarkable accuracy, thereby improving the overall quality of dental care available in Vietnam.
Another pivotal advancement gaining traction in Vietnamese dental labs is 3D printing technology. This method allows for the quick production of dental models and appliances directly from digital files, significantly reducing the time required for traditional manufacturing processes. For instance, dental labs are now capable of printing custom aligners and surgical guides, which not only streamline patient treatment plans but also ensure a higher level of customization that corresponds directly to individual patient needs.
Furthermore, the adoption of digital scanners has become increasingly common in dental practices across Vietnam. These scanners facilitate the capture of highly accurate impressions without the discomfort associated with traditional methods. By converting physical impressions into digital formats, dental labs enhance communication between dentists and lab technicians, leading to fewer errors and improved turnaround times. Additionally, the potential for remote collaboration over digital files allows Vietnamese dental labs to work more seamlessly with international partners, broadening their market reach.

Quality Standards and Regulations
In Vietnam, dental laboratories are subject to a range of quality standards and regulations designed to ensure the delivery of safe and effective dental products. To operate legally, these labs must undergo a rigorous certification process overseen by the Ministry of Health and other relevant authorities. This certification guarantees that the dental lab adheres to specific guidelines regarding the materials used, equipment employed, and overall operational practices.
A crucial component of these regulations is the emphasis on quality control. Dental labs are required to implement systematic quality assurance protocols to monitor and evaluate their services continuously. This may include regular assessments of the manufacturing processes, meticulous testing of dental products, and routine training for technicians to stay abreast of the latest industry standards. Such proactive measures are vital for safeguarding both the health of patients and the reputation of dental professionals who rely on these laboratories.
Despite the established standards, dental labs in Vietnam face various challenges in maintaining these quality benchmarks. One significant issue is the variable availability of high-quality materials, which can lead to inconsistencies in the final products. Additionally, many smaller labs may struggle with limited resources or lack access to the latest technologies. To mitigate these challenges, labs often collaborate with international partners, engage in continuous professional development for their staff, and invest in modern equipment, ensuring they can adhere to both local and global quality standards.
